Abstract

Transient climate sensitivity relates total climate forcings from anthropogenic and other sources to surface temperature. Global transient climate sensitivity is well studied, as are the related concepts of equilibrium climate sensitivity (ECS) and transient climate response (TCR), but spatially disaggregated local climate sensitivity (LCS) is less so. An energy balance model (EBM) and an easily implemented semiparametric statistical approach are proposed to estimate LCS using the historical record and to assess its contribution to global transient climate sensitivity. Results suggest that areas dominated by ocean tend to import energy, they are relatively more sensitive to forcings, but they warm more slowly than areas dominated by land. Economic implications are discussed.

Abstract

In this chapter the potential to use water-based Trombe walls to provide heated water for building applications during the summer months is investigated. Design Builder software is used to model a simple single-story building with a south-facing Trombe wall. The effects of using different thermal storage mediums within the Trombe wall on building heating loads during the winter and building cooling loads during the summer are modeled. The amount of thermal energy stored and temperature of water within the thermal storage medium during hot weather conditions were also simulated. On a sunny day on Toronto, Canada, the average temperature of the water in a Trombe wall integrated into a single-story building can reach ∼57°C, which is high enough to provide for the main hot water usages in buildings. Furthermore, the amount of water heated is three times greater than that required in an average household in Canada. The results from this work suggest that water-based Trombe walls have great potential to enhance the flexibility and utility of Trombe walls by providing heated water for building applications during summer months, without compromising performance during winter months.

Abstract

Health scientists and urban planners have long been interested in the influence that the built environment has on the physical activities in which we engage, the environmental hazards we face, the kinds of amenities we enjoy, and the resulting impacts on our health. However, it is widely recognized that the extent of this influence, and the specific cause-and-effect relationships that exist, are still relatively unclear. Recent reviews highlight the need for more individual-level data on daily activities (especially physical activity) over long periods of time linked spatially to real-world characteristics of the built environment in diverse settings, along with a wide range of personal mediating variables. While capturing objective data on the built environment has benefited from wide-scale availability of detailed land use and transport network databases, the same cannot be said of human activity. A more diverse history of data collection methods exists for such activity and continues to evolve owing to a variety of quickly emerging wearable sensor technologies. At present, no “gold standard” method has emerged for assessing physical activity type and intensity under the real-world conditions of the built environment; in fact, most methods have barely been tested outside of the laboratory, and those that have tend to experience significant drops in accuracy and reliability. This paper provides a review of these diverse methods and emerging technologies, including biochemical, self-report, direct observation, passive motion detection, and integrated approaches. Based on this review and current needs, an integrated three-tiered methodology is proposed, including: (1) passive location tracking (e.g., using global positioning systems); (2) passive motion/biometric tracking (e.g., using accelerometers); and (3) limited self-reporting (e.g., using prompted recall diaries). Key development issues are highlighted, including the need for proper validation and automated activity-detection algorithms. The paper ends with a look at some of the key lessons learned and new opportunities that have emerged at the crossroads of urban studies and health sciences.

Abstract

The chapter tries to trace the development of concept of urban ecosystem as a problem-solving approach for urban problems, including the unwarranted problems caused by climate change. Urban management has increasingly shifted from infrastructure-based to a more regional-based approach. There has been a shift in the domain of urban ecosystem as well, from the established urbanized area to the aggregation of urban and surrounding rural area. Also, urban-rural linkages are given more attention in resource management in urban areas, thereby reducing the overall risk due to climate change. The chapter provides examples and challenges of urban ecosystem management from across the world.

Abstract

Living with physical hazards is an everyday issue for the people of Bangladesh because different seasons bring different kinds of uncertainties. Sometimes traditional knowledge and practices (Alam, 2007) help them to adjust to these conditions; in some occasions, these hazards turn into catastrophic disasters causing deaths and bringing unbearable damages in different sectors. In addition to the tangible damages incurred due to hazards, in most of the cases, these hazards injure the internal social organizations at different levels (for example, household, community, and institutional) and affect their assets. Thus, the community resilience is greatly weakened, which makes people susceptible to upcoming hazards. Scientists suggest that climate change-induced threats and uncertainties in the forms of erratic rainfall patterns that result in drought conditions and sometimes floods, abnormal foggy conditions, change in the wind direction and the characteristic patterns of seasons, anomalies in the temperature regimes, and the occurrence of cyclones will bring new dimensions to existing situations. These natural hazards, temperature rises, and sea level rise–induced inundations will contribute to the breakdown of the traditional systems of living; they also bring change in topographical factors (for example, flooding), biophysical factors (changes in the crop yields, runoff, risks of the spread of infectious diseases, changes in the vegetation pattern), and socioeconomic factors (per capital income, health, education, population density) (World Bank, 2001).

Abstract

In the context of natural disasters and climate change, ecosystems are critical natural capital because of their ability to regulate climate and natural hazards. This chapter examines the important role of ecosystems and their services in disaster risk reduction and climate change adaptation. It discusses the relevance of adopting ecosystem-based approaches in managing risks brought about by a changing climate.

Abstract

Strategic decisions leaders make involving organizational changes such as mergers and acquisitions (M&A), divestitures, and downsizing, which can influence and/or interact with other organizational factors. For example, within the context of M&A, changes impact financial performance, firm behaviors, and organizational culture. In addition, strategic decisions for these types of change can also interrelate with other more intrapersonal factors, including both leaders’ and employees’ health and well-being. Employee stress, also referred to as “merger syndrome,” outlines individual negative impacts of the changes including, but not limited to, cynicism and distrust, change wariness, and burnout, all accumulating to psychological effects including increases in detachment to work, stress, and sick leave. In this chapter, the authors outline the different impacts M&A phases have on stress and well-being and how they interrelate with the strategic decisions leaders make. The authors also outline future research opportunities and practical implications for how leaders and employees could better manage future major changes such as M&A activities.

Abstract

Many scholars have reflected on Ricardo’s comparative advantage theory, but little has been said about Yoruba economic thoughts, especially in the exchange and distribution of articles of trade. Prior to the arrival of the Europeans and their activities in the economy of Yorubaland in the pre-colonial period, communities had traded in local, distant markets and across frontiers with neighbours in exchange for products different to the ones they produced. This happened because different towns had specialised in the production of articles which were environmentally suitable to it. Soil fertility, dictated by environmental factors, was a determining factor in what was produced, as agriculture was essentially the predominant economic activity. Textile industries were also established which equally stimulated long-distance trade as specialised clothes were made for export to neighbouring regions. A number of Yoruba towns have been selected for this analysis. The work presents Yoruba economic thoughts and initiatives, and the activities of the indigenous people in the pre-colonial period in Yorubaland and critically assesses the articles which different towns produced for export to other cities and kingdoms in Yorubaland and beyond. Primary source in form of interviews were conducted, proverbs, and secondary sources such as books and journals were also consulted for this work. The economic thought of the people based on specialising in advantaged goods or what they easily produced and achieved is worth historical investigation as a means of celebrating their economic thoughts in a free market.
